Exegesis

The particle hos {ὡς | hōs} introduces a manner comparison hos paron to deuteron {ὡς παρὼν τὸ δεύτερον | hōs parṓn tò deúteron}, literally “as though present the second time,” with the participle paron {παρὼν | parṓn} functioning temporally.

In context2 Corinthians 13:2

I have spoken previously and now give advance warning once more—as though I were present the second time , and now being absent—to those who sinned earlier and to all the rest, that if I return, I will not spare .
